If you wish to defend against the claims set forth in the following pages, you must take prompt action. You are warned that if you fail to do so, the case may proceed without you and a decree of divorce or annulment may be entered against you by the Court. A judgment may also be entered against you for any other claim or relief requested in these papers by the Plaintiff. You may lose money or property or other rights important to you, including custody or visitation of your children. When the ground for divorce is indignities or irretrievable breakdown of the marriage, you may request marriage counseling. This notice is to advise you that in accordance with Section 3302(d) of the Divorce Code, you may request that the court require you and your spouse to attend marriage counseling prior to a divorce being handed down by the court. A list of professional marriage counselors is available at the Domestic Relations Office, 13 North Hanover Street, Carlisle, Pennsylvania. You are advised that this list is kept as a convenience to you and you are not bound to choose a counselor from this list. All necessary arrangements and the cost of counseling sessions are to be borne by you and your spouse. If you desire to pursue counseling, you must make your request for counseling within twenty days of the date on which you receive this notice. Failure to do so will constitute a waiver of your right to request counseling. Michael S.
